Pineda <br />Director <br />We have received your application to renew your permit to conduct coal mining in Colorado. Our <br />initial review indicates that all preliminary items required by Rule 2.08.5(2)(b) have not been <br />submitted. Thus, your application is incomplete for the purposes of filing as of February 24, 2012. <br />Rule 2.07.3(2) includes the requirement that the proposed notice of publication shall include the <br />precise location and boundaries of the land to be affected by the proposed surface coal mining <br />operation. As further clarified in 2.07.3(2)(b), this may be accomplished by map or by description. <br />Please revise the proposed public notice to include 1) a detailed list of the all of the Sections (and <br />portions thereof) that lie within the permit boundary; or 2) a map which fulfills the requirements of <br />the rules. <br />In accordance with Rule 2.07.3(1), you have the opportunity to amend, review, or otherwise make <br />your application complete. <br />If you have any questions, please contact me. <br />Sincerely, <br />Marcia L.
